Now LK Advani, Ramdev to get Padma award
New Delhi, Jan 6: You may be a little perturbed after knowing that BJP government will soon award some more people having Hindutava connection. Reports say that names of BJP veteran LK Advani and Yoga guru Ramdev are doing rounds for Padma awards. Apart from these, the list also includes vedic scholar and professor David Frawley.
Advani is one of the founding members of the BJP who gave party new high through his hardcore Hindutva agenda in nineties, while Ramdev is known for his pro-BJP approach in political circle.
On December 25, the Modi Government had announced that former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ee and freedom fighter Pandit Madan Mohan Malaviya will be awarded the Bharat Ratna, India's highest civilian honour.
BSP chief has already alleged that Government is discriminating luminaries on the basis of their caste. "Just like the previous Congress-led UPA government, the NDA government is adopting the same discriminatory attitude while honouring two persons of the same caste - Vajpayee and Malviya - with the Bharat Ratna recently," she told a press conference.
At a time when controversy has already engulfed the highly prestigious civilian awards after some sports persons allegedly lobbied for it, this move of the Government may earn them the opposition's ire.
The issue erupted on Friday with Saina tweeting her disappointment at her application not being considered for a Padma Bhushan, India's third highest civilian award. "Friends, I am not demanding for the award... My question was why my name was not sent to the home ministry (sic)," she wrote.
Earlier, the outgoing Jammu and Kashmir Chief Minister Omar Abdullah today said it was a "great pity" that athletes feel they have to "lobby" and "jostle with each other" for Padma awards. Omar's comments came after boxer Vijender Singh on Tuesday asked the Boxing Federation to recommend his name to the Sports Ministry for Padma Bhushan.
